KILGORE COLLEGE RANGERS ALREADY PRACTICING; SPRING GAME IS APRIL 26
      The Kilgore College Rangers football program, headed by head coach J.J. Eckert (center), has started its spring practice, and in fact, the Rangers will play their spring game on Saturday, April 26 at R.E. St. John Memorial Stadium at 11 a.m.
